The pairing of Future Funk with Disco is a match made in musical heaven. The genre is, by its very definition, a re-imagining of disco, funk, and boogie for the modern era. The four-on-the-floor beat is the unbroken thread that links the two, creating a seamless bridge between the glittering dance floors of the '70s and the virtual raves of today.
